Malicious java applets are widely used to deliver malicious software to remote systems. In this work, we present HoneyAgent which allows for the dynamic analysis of java applets, bypassing common obfuscation techniques. This enables security researchers to quickly comprehend the functionality of an examined applet and to unveil malicious behavior. In order to trace the behavior of a sample as far as possible, HoneyAgent is further able to simulate various vulnerabilities allowing analysts for example to identify the malware that should finally be installed by the applet. In our evaluation, we show that HoneyAgent is able to reliably detect malicious applets used by common exploit kits with no false positives. By using a combination of heuristics as well as signatures applied to observed method invocations, HoneyAgent is further able to identify exploited common vulnerabilities and exposures in many cases.

The Internet offers many new software technologies - the most notable is java. java not only specifies a computer language but serves also as a complete toolbox for building client/server solutions. We use this technology for developing a framework for remote computation. As application example serves the parametric multicriteria robustness exploration of the dynamics of a high-fidelity aircraft model

WWW-based coursewares will benefit from libraries of subject-specific software objects that are embeddable in HTML documents. Development of libraries of java applet programs in various subject areas is timely and important. The developed applet library should enable educators to include these applet programs in their HTML-based multimedia courseware. This paper discusses the development and utilization of java applet programs in the area of solid state materials and devices. The applet programs developed so far, with the purpose of providing a dynamic visual simulation of solid-state material concepts and device principles, are included in the courseware section.
